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
347407275 802261277 166 3686510
25270196903 1713126399 420
25270196903 1713126399 420
054 68 387
All about undefined
Interested in learning more?
25270196903 1713126399 420
054 68 387
See more
04581380 19904 4257
01277894876 6521383966 7186
See more
6713974 72490865
6628393814 809370 36193906 3270
See more